Not Installing Your Dish Washer Properly Can Result In a Mountain of Troubles
Not just can installing a dish washer correctly invalidate your guarantee, yet it can likewise develop a mess. For instance, if you do not install the supply line properly, you can deal with leakages-- or perhaps worse, a flood. You may lik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also rapidly with your pipes and also creates loud trembling noises. If you inaccurately mount your dishwashing machine to the rubbish disposal, you might observe pungent smells or have deposit on your dishes.

A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, specifically a dishwashing machine port, links the dishwashing machine to a water source. If you acquire a brand-new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and water source. If you make a decision to make use of an existing supply line, an expert plumber can inspect it to ensure that it remains in good condition as well as does not have any type of leaks.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
